By the time you read this entry, you will most likely know about the new Terms of Service and have agreed to them. It’s been on my to-do list for forever and has not been one of my favorite things to create on this site.

But it’s necessary and provides rules and protection. You’ll also notice that there are now links in the site footer to the various items: Terms of Service, Privacy Policy, and Rules. And also a Contact page since I never added that.

Hopefully it’s all pretty straight-forward with nothing unexpected. I’m not trying to sneak anything in that isn’t standard for most communities these days.

It’s kind of a crazy week, so if I get inundated with questions and requests, please be patient with me. Thanks for helping to keep Prosebox a safe and happy place to be.
